Enhancing logical thinking in math for children aged 6-9 lays a critical foundation for their future academic success and overall cognitive development. At this tender age, children's brains are highly receptive and able to absorb new concepts rapidly. Logical thinking helps them comprehend mathematical principles, turning abstract ideas into structured, understandable patterns. This not only makes learning math easier but also boosts their problem-solving skills.
For parents or teachers, fostering logical thinking translates into better academic performance across subjects. Children learn to approach complex problems with a strategic mindset, breaking them down into manageable steps. This, in turn, builds confidence and promotes a love for learning.
Moreover, logical thinking helps in day-to-day decision-making and nurtures critical life skills such as planning, analyzing, and reasoning. For example, making connections between different pieces of information becomes effortless, which is vital for real-world problem solving.
Incorporating games, puzzles, and hands-on activities related to math can make learning enjoyable and engaging. Such interactive methods ensure that math is seen not as a chore but as an exciting challenge.
Ultimately, investing in the development of logical thinking in math equips children with essential skills for future academic pursuits and a prosperous, well-rounded life.
